ING Direct opens first US cafe

ING Direct bank has opened its first US ING Direct Cafe in New York.

Located on 45 East 49th Street between Park and Madison Avenues, customers can enjoy a Peetts coffee, orange soda or other beverage while pondering the merits of ING Direct banking accounts and investments.

Computer terminals are available for customers to open an account online, check their account status or move funds via the ING Direct Web site. Customers can also surf the Internet for free.

Phones will connect customers directly with an ING Direct sales associate. Visitors can also get information about bank products from the cafe staff and select from a wide range of ING Direct merchandise.

"We want people to experience banking that is as easy as having a cup of coffee," says ING Direct's president and CEO Arkadi Kuhlmann. "The ING Direct Cafes have been very successful in Canada, Australia, France, Spain and Italy...I'm sure consumers in the US will enjoy them, too. And we serve good coffee!"

The bank plans to open additional outlets in the US this year, with Philadelphia, Wilmington, DE, Los Angeles and St. Cloud, MN to follow New York.
